Texas 2023 - 88th Regular

Texas House Bill HR660

Caption

In memory of Sarah Frances McMullan, founder of the Lamp-Lite Theatre in Nacogdoches.

Summary

H.R. No. 660 is a resolution dedicated to honoring the life and contributions of Sarah Frances McMullan, a prominent figure in the East Texas theater community. The resolution recognizes her longstanding commitment to the arts, particularly through her establishment of the Lamp-Lite Theatre in Nacogdoches. McMullan, who began her theater career at a young age, directed over 320 productions and played a vital role in nurturing local talent, making her an influential mentor in the region's artistic landscape.
